ROUNDTABLE: Can Pat Healy make a run at Ben Henderson's UFC Lightweight Championship after UFC 159 win?

Can Pat Healy make a run to the UFC Lightweight Championship after that highly impressive win over Jim Miller at UFC 159?


RICH HANSEN, MMATORCH COLUMNIST

No. He beat Jim Miller, who got eviscerated my middle of the road Nate Diaz, who himself got slaughtered by the current champion. Not to mention Jim Miller getting handled easily by the current champion back in August 2011. I understand that MMAMath doesn't usually work, but sometimes it does.


C.J. TUTTLE, MMATORCH CONTRIBUTOR

I wasn't that impressed to be honest. Yes, he did overcome some adversity to get the victory but the guy is 30-16. While he has won seven in a row, I would like to see that winning streak continue in the UFC before we start throwing around the "title shot" phrase. Plus, before anything else happens I'd like to see him rectify the loss he suffered to a much more impressive Josh Thomson. I think we all too often see someone win and immediately throw there names in the hat for a shot, when in reality they still have a ways to go.


FRANK HYDEN, MMATORCH CONTRIBUTOR

I think so, it's just going to take a while. He's going to need a few more wins before he can earn a shot. The division's still a little crowded, but I think he can do it. I'd say two more big wins should do it.


BRAD WALKER, MMATORCH COLUMNIST

Short Answer: No. Long Answer: Probably not. Jim Miller is just like Dustin Poirier in that he shows a ton of promise and then falls right back down the ladder. Healy beating Miller was undoubtedly an upset but is he ever going to make a title run in the UFC? Probably not.


TONY BECERRA, MMATORCH CONTRIBUTOR

I think he can be a legitimate contender with a few more solid performances like Saturday nights. Pat said in the post fight conference no one in the 155 division can "out-grind him," so for starters how about rematch with Josh Thomson and then we'll go from there.


ERIC HOBAUGH, MMATORCH CONTRIBUTOR

I think that Pat Healy can make a run at the title, but ultimately he will not win the title. He is a great fighter in many elements of MMA, but he is not an elite fighter in any area. He looked good against Miller, but then again Miller is not one of the best lightweights in the UFC.


ANWAR PEREZ, MMATORCH COLUMNIST

Pat Healy is a good fighter that showed some fortitude in beating Jim Miller after Miller dominated Healy in the first. Healy has a ways to go before getting a title shot but a couple wins against top contenders or even one, impressive win against a former champion could do the trick to get Healy that title shot.


DAN MOORE, MMATORCH UK COLUMNIST

Only Pat Healy and his team gave Pat Healy a chance of winning this fight. Even those of you who actually predicted a Healy win probably did so without any confidence. Let's not forget, he was very close to losing in that first round. For that reason alone, I'll refrain from predicting a title run for him.

This win was impressive though and his run at lightweight has been excellent thus far, if not a little under the radar. Even if the UFC don't usually match winners vs. losers, they should make an exception for Melendez vs. Healy. If he gets past the former Strikeforce champion, we'll know he's the real deal and a serious contender for Benson Henderson.
